The Department of Defense has submitted to OMB for clearance, the following proposal for collection of information under the provisions of the Paperwork Reduction Act (44 U.S.C. Chapter 35).

Title, Form Numbers, and OMB Number: Telecommunications Service Priority System; SF Form(s) 314, 315, 317, 318, and 319; OMB Number 0704-0305.

Type of Request: Extension.

Number of Respondents: 94.

Responses per Respondent: 42 (average).

Annual Responses: 3,940.

Average Burden per Response: 1.2 hours.

Annual Burden Hours: 4,815.

Needs and Uses: The Telecommunications Service Priority (TSP) System forms are used to determine participation in the TSP system, facilitate TSP system administrative requirements, and to maintain TSP system database accuracy. The purpose of the TSP system is to provide a legal basis for telecommunications vendors to provide priority provisioning and restoration of telecommunications services supporting national security or emergency preparedness functions. The information gathered via the TSP system forms is the minimum necessary for the National Communications System to effectively manage the TSP system.

Affected Public: Businesses or Other For-Profit; State, Local, or Tribal Government.

Frequency: On Occasion.

Respondents Obligation: Required to obtain or retain benefits.
